About this map

The Southern railroad line serves as a central spine for this South Georgia landscape, connecting the town of Hahira in the north to the settlement of Mineola and the modern Mineola Interchange further south. The Withlacoochee River meanders through the central and eastern portions of the map, fed by tributaries like Twin Creek, Bay Branch, and Cherry Creek. This survey captures a mix of rural agrarian foundations and mid-century suburban expansion, particularly around Highland Heights and the northern outskirts of Valdosta near Five Points.
